The VA need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to maintain emergency generators at the Chillicothe VA Medical Center.
Key Details
The VA need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to perform preventative maintenance on 10 emergency generators, 3 standby generators, and 3 mobile generators at the Chillicothe VA Medical Center. The contractor will perform annual and semi-annual service, annual load banking, and take oil and fuel samples.
- What's the contract structure and timeline?
This is a base and four option years procurement.
- How will they pick the winner?
The evaluation basis is not specified.
- When and how do you bid?
Proposals are due on June 19, 2026, and must be submitted through SAM.gov.
Who can apply
- Must be a certified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B)
